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ions
Internet Explorer version 6
Description
The issue all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files by tricking a user into typing the characters of the target filename in a text box and using the OnKeyDown, OnKeyPress, and OnKeyUp Javascript keystroke events to change the focus and cause those characters to be inserted into a file upload input control, which can then upload the file when the user submits the form.
Recommendations
For Internet Explorer version 6, consider disabling the use of Javascript keystroke events OnKeyDown, OnKeyPress, and OnKeyUp as a temporary workaround until a patch is available. Restrict access to file upload input controls to minimize the risk of exploitation. Avoid using file upload features in Internet Explorer version 6 until the issue is resolved.
